Recently looking to purchase a Rav 4. It has 90000 miles on the clock? Pterol engine (motorway miles)

Is this somthing we should be concerned with? Or do these vehicles go on for ever?

RAV's are generally bullet proof and last forever... Mine has done 105000+ miles...(also a Diesel)

Best check the service history...etc is intact, Also what year is it and model shape (see HERE for model range details)

Mileage is no great problem. You can always get a compression test done. Company cars get all the services normally so I'd say all is well.

My 1994 3 door has done 174,000 and apart from my chosen turbo engine swap almost all else is as original.
